Based on our analysis of NIST CSF 2.0 coverage, core features, company size fit, deployment model, here is our conclusion:
Mid-market and enterprise security teams drowning in data exfiltration incidents will find real value in CyStack Endpoint's file-level DLP combined with automated policy enforcement by department, which actually stops the leak before it happens rather than just logging it. The tool covers PR.DS and PR.PS effectively, meaning you get both data classification teeth and device lockdown in one agent. Skip this if you need advanced threat hunting or EDR-grade behavioral analytics; CyStack prioritizes prevention and control over detection, which is exactly the point.
Mid-market and SMB security teams managing distributed workforces will get the most from Rawstream Endpoint Agent because its local proxy-based filtering works equally well on-network and off-network without requiring constant cloud callbacks. Active Directory integration and Citrix support mean you can deploy it across hybrid environments without rearchitecting your identity layer, and real-time bandwidth tracking gives you actual visibility into what's consuming your pipe instead of guesses. Skip this if you need endpoint detection and response capabilities; Rawstream is content filtering and application monitoring, not threat hunting.

CyStack Endpoint: Endpoint DLP, device mgmt & security policy enforcement for enterprises. built by CyStack. Core capabilities include Data classification by file type, file name, and keywords, Data Loss Prevention (DLP) to block sensitive data exfiltration, Anti-ransomware backup..
Rawstream Endpoint Agent: Endpoint agent providing web filtering and app monitoring on/off network. built by Rawstream. Core capabilities include Local HTTP/S proxy-based web filtering, 80+ domain categories for content filtering, Block/allow lists with wildcard support..
Both serve the Endpoint Protection Platform market but differ in approach, feature depth, and target audience.
CyStack Endpoint differentiates with Data classification by file type, file name, and keywords, Data Loss Prevention (DLP) to block sensitive data exfiltration, Anti-ransomware backup. Rawstream Endpoint Agent differentiates with Local HTTP/S proxy-based web filtering, 80+ domain categories for content filtering, Block/allow lists with wildcard support.
